Tamara Letourneau named assistant CEO/administrative services director
Posted Date: 2/7/2014

Tamara Letourneau
Tamara Letourneau, who has served as interim assistant chief executive officer for Costa Mesa for three years, has been hired as the City’s assistant chief executive officer/administrative services director.
Letourneau, whose first day in the permanent position will be Feb. 17, will oversee human resources, labor relations, the Parks and Community Services Department, county-run libraries in Costa Mesa, and employee development and communications, among other duties.
“Tammy’s expertise, professionalism and commitment to public service has served the City extremely well over the past three years,” said City CEO Tom Hatch. “We’re very fortunate that she will now be part of the Costa Mesa’s permanent management team.”

Letourneau—who has 25 years of experience in local government—worked for the City as a contract employee through Management Partners. Prior to working at Management Partners, Letourneau was the city manager for Yorba Linda and Sierra Madre. 
She also is an adjunct professor at California State Polytechnic University Pomona and the University of La Verne. Letourneau is the current co-chair and a founding member of Women Leading Government and is also the current co-chair of the Cal ICMA Ethics Committee. In addition, she is a contributor to the book “Democracy at the Doorstep, Too!” by Mike Conduff and Melissa Byre Vossmer, which was published in 2012.
She ear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Business Administration California State Polytechnic University Pomona and a master’s degree in Public Administration from California State University, Long Beach.

Her annual salary will be $183,852.
